Output 898922e3a79be6079fce44979c6e7283f8dbda38102d58ee5bb1a7666539cf74:11

value
709636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a467a2340d96384d8c05ed2ef062d827e1aca158 OP_EQUAL
address
3GgJtbMhLQREJd4vFHxw88rtzM1rhymVKR
transaction
898922e3a79be6079fce44979c6e7283f8dbda38102d58ee5bb1a7666539cf74
confirmations
350589
spent
true